A crowd of Marines and family members gather during Marine Tactical Electronic Warfare Squadron 4’s deactivation ceremony at Marine Corps Air Station Cherry Point, N.C., June 2, 2017. VMAQ-4, Marine Aircraft Group 14, 2nd Marine Aircraft Wing, has officially completed their sundown after 35 years of supporting operations around the world.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Cpl. Jason Jimenez/ Released)
